Provide First Aid
HLTAID011 - Provide First Aid (Includes CPR)
​
Course Overview
This course equips participants with the skills and knowledge to provide first aid in compliance with the Australian Resuscitation Council (ARC) guidelines.
Who is this course for?
-
Individuals requiring first aid skills for workplaces or community scenarios.
-
School leavers or mature learners seeking employment.
-
Workers renewing qualifications.
Course Relevance and Requirements:
-
Perfect for workplace or community emergency situations
-
Annual CPR refresher recommended.
-
Certification renewal every 3 years (ARC guidelines.
-
Check local Work Health and Safety regulations for compliance needs.

Additional Notes:
-
The practical assessment for all accredited courses will require each participant to perform 2 minutes of CPR on an adult mannikin on the floor.
-
Each participant also needs a USI (Unique Student Identifier) for the certificates to be issued by the RTO.
